Objective:To observe the clinical features of nine foveal hypoplasia (FVH) patients in a family.Methods:A retrospective clinical study. In August 2018, nine patients with FVH from a family diagnosed in Qilu Hospital of Shandong University (Qingdao) were included in this study. Detailed medical history of the proband was collected. Best corrected visual acuity (BCVA), slit-lamp, cycloplegic refraction, fundus color photography, optical coherence tomography (OCT) and OCT angiography (OCTA) were performed on the proband. The peripheral venous blood of V7 (family member), the proband and the proband's parents were collected for DNA extraction, and gene detection was performed.Results:The proband, a four-year-old girl, had poor vision with BCVA of 0.4 in both eyes. OCT showed absence of foveal pit, absence of outer segment lengthening, absence of outer nuclear layer widening and incursion of inner retinal layers. The proband's mother was 32 years old, and macular foveal reflection was not observed in her eyes. OCT and OCTA examination showed no foveal pit and foveal avascular zone in both eyes. Both eyes of the proband and her mother were diagnosed with Thomas grade 4 FVH. The other seven patients also had no foveal pit, and could be categorized into Thomas grade 3 or 4. No significant pathogenic genes and mutation sites were detected in the proband through whole genome sequencing, and no copy number variation or chromosomal abnormality associated with the phenotype of the proband was detected. After seven months of amblyopia treatment, the proband's BCVA had improved to 0.5 in the right eye and 0.6 in the left eye, while the BCVA did not change after 2 years of follow-up.Conclusion:Nine FVH patients in this family had no foveal pit with similar OCT images, and their visual acuity was affected from lightly to severely. Early amblyopia training is helpful to improve the visual acuity of child patients.

Objective:To explore the correlation between the semiquantitative score of bone ultrasound and the WOMAC OA index in knee osteoarthritis.Methods:From March 2017 to December 2018, 118 patients with knee osteoarthritis diagnosed and treated in Taizhou Hospital of Traditional Chinese Medicine were selected in the research.The patients' bone erosion, joint effusion, synovium hyperplasia and meniscus were evaluated by ultrasound semiquantitative scoring system.Osteoarthritis index of the patients was investigated at the same time.The correlation between the semiquantitative score of myoskeletal ultrasound and WOMAC OA index in knee osteoarthritis was analyzed.Results:In 118 patients with knee osteoarthritis, the semiquantitative scores of myoskeletal ultrasound of bone erosion was (2.33±0.37)points, joint effusion was (2.05±0.26)points, synovial hyperplasia was (2.24±0.15)points, abnormal meniscus position was (1.67±0.28)points, meniscus shape and signal was (1.15±0.14)points.The WOMAC OA index scores of patients' pain was (29.52±6.68)points, stiffness was (11.43±3.78)points, dysfunction was (93.85±18.73)points, and total score was (134.80±29.19)points.The scores of bone erosion, joint effusion, synovium hyperplasia and meniscus in semiquantitative score of muscle and bone ultrasound were positively correlated with the total score of WOMAC OA index( r=0.435, 0.317, 0.429, 0.294, 0.282, all P<0.05). Conclusion:Semiquantitative score of muscle and bone ultrasound can better reflect the degree of knee joint injury, which is positively correlated with WOMAC OA index.We can use the semiquantitative score of muscle and bone ultrasound and WOMAC OA index to predict the condition of patients with knee osteoarthritis.

Objective To study the effects of abiotic elicitors methyl jasmonate (MeJA) and salicylic acid (SA) on the alkaloids accumulation and related enzymes metabolism inPinellia ternata suspension cell cultures. Methods Using the leaf petioles-derived suspension cell cultures as the study object, the culture duration, concentrations of MeJA and SA were determined to get the optimal alkaloids accumulation, and the activities of metabolic enzymes IMP dehydrogenase and sAMP synthase were also measured.Results A 9-fold of dried biomass and a 3-fold of alkaloids accumulation were observed inP. ternata suspension cell cultures after culture for 21 d. Both MeJA and SA could significantly promote the accumulation of alkaloids inP. ternata suspension cells. 150 μmol/L MeJA enhanced alkaloids content (4.7 mg/gDW) by 3.6 folds in comparison with control group, whereas 50 μmol/L SA showed a 2.5-fold increase. Meanwhile, 100 μmol/L MeJA and 50 μmol/L SA promoted the increase in IMP dehydrogenase activity by 3.0 and 3.7 fold respectively, and 150 μmol/L MeJA and 100 μmol/L SA showed the increase by 2.6 and 4.4 fold respectively.Conclusion Proper adding exogenous MeJA and SA can promote the accumulation of alkaloids inPinellia ternata suspension cell cultures.

Objective To analyze the situation and change trend of health resources allocation of traditional Chinese medicine (TCM).Methods The agglomeration degree is used to analyze the situation and change trend of health resources allocation of TCM in different regionS.Results The regional disparity of health resource allocation of TCM is large,and the equity of health resources allocation according to geography and population needs to be further improved and optimized.Conclusion The availability of health resources of TCM should be improved,and the diversified needs of TCM in different regions be met.

Objective To explore changes of parameters of compressed nerve roots on diffusion tensor imaging (DTI) and relationship between the parameters and symptoms assessed with Oswestry disability index (ODI) and visual analogue score (VAS) in patients with lumbar disc herniation.Methods Twenty-five patients confirmed by surgery for single compressed nerve root with lumbar disc herniation who underwent DTI scanning before operation were enrolled.All patients were scored using ODI and VAS,and the areas of characteristic leg pain were compared with compressed nerve root for ODI and VAS.Results FA values of the compressed and normal nerve roots of these patients were 0.26 ±-0.05 and 0.36-±-0.05,while ADC values were (1.69 ±-0.32) × 10-3 mm2/s and (1.56 ± 0.21) × 10-3 mm2/s,respectively.Negative correlation was found between FA values of the compressed nerve roots and ODI (r=-0.88,P<0.01) as well as VAS (r=-0.66,P<0.01),but no correlation between ADC values and ODI (r=0.30,P =0.15) nor VAS (r=0.36,P =0.08) was found.Conclusion FA values derived from DTI maybe vital parameters of quantifying changes of structure of nerve root.Injury of nerve root structure in patients with lumbar disc herniation could be crucial for clinical symptoms.

<p><b>OBJECTIVE</b>Tocompare the effects of different waveforms and parameters of electrical stimulation to elicit a blink, and construct a functional electrical stimulation (FES) system to restore synchronous blink in unilateral facial nerve palsy (FNP).</p><p><b>METHODS</b>Firstly, twenty-four rabbits were surgically induced unilateral FNP and were divided into three groups, who received square, sine and triangle pulse wareforms, respectirely. Both the healthy and the paralysis eyelids of the rabbits received pulse train stimulation to produce a blink in both eyes. For each rabbit, twenty-seven combinations of frequencies (25 Hz, 50 Hz and 100 Hz) and nine pulse widths (1-9 ms) were stimulated. The threshold amplitude and electric charge to elicit a blink was compared between different waveforms and different parameters. Secondly, a FES system was constructed to treat six surgically induced unilateral FNP rabbit chosen in the twenty-four rabbits, it consisted by an electromyogram (EMG) amplifier module which record the EMG of the healthy muscle, and a stimulator which received the EMG input and output a pulse train stimulation when triggered by the EMG.</p><p><b>RESULTS</b>When the carrier frequency of the pulse train was 25 Hz, it was not able to induce a smooth blink. However, when the carrier frequencies were 50 Hz and 100 Hz, a smooth blink could be induced. The voltage required by 100 Hz was lower than 50 Hz, but it cost more electric charge. The amplitude that square waveforms required was far lower than sine and triangle, but the electric charge between the three waveforms was similar. Synchronous blink could be restored in the six unilateral FNP rabbits with the FES system.</p><p><b>CONCLUSIONS</b>To elicit a blink, square pulse train delivered in 50 Hz is a preferable option. The motion of the healthy eyelids as a source of information for stimulation of the paralyzed sides can restore the synchronous blink in unilateral FNP rabbits.</p>

OBJECTIVE@#To investigate the surgical technique of the pericanal electrode insertion technique for ies cochlear implantation.@*METHOD@#Forty cases of sensorineural deafness were subjected to the ies cochlear implants. Cochleostomy was performed through the external auditory canal with a microdrill anterior to the round window. The electrode impedance and electrically auditory brainstem responses(EABR) were tested during the operation. The X-ray photographs were taken after the operation. The cochlear implant was activated in all 40 cases 4 weeks following surgery.@*RESULT@#All of the electrodes were inserted and all of the implants worked well. No electrode extrusions or serious surgical complications happened during postoperative observation for 6 months.@*CONCLUSION@#The pericanal electrode insertion technique is a safe approach for ies cochlear implantation.

Objective To explore techniques of endoscopic ultrasonography for nasal cavity and its accuracy. Methods Under the guidance of nasal endoscope, ultrasonography of nasal cavity was performed by using a 10 MHz,3. 3 mm section probes. Thirty nasal cavities of 15 normal canine were scanned under general anesthesia. The sink experiment was used to decrease the influence of the ultraphonic artifact and to correct the data error. Results In gray scale ultrasound,most mucous and submucous tissue within nasal cavity were hypoechoic, the septal cartilage was echoless, and the cartilaginous membrane of the septal cartilage showed a consecutive hyperechogenicity line. The average thickness of the nasal septum and the average thickness of the inboard mucous and submuous of the inferior turbinate were (1. 87 0. 33)mm and (2.96 0.36) mm respectively. The rich blood flowing signals were observed by CDFI in soft tissues mentioned above. Pulsed Doppler of the nasal septum showed a venous waveform with the velocity ranging from 3. 1 to 13.8 cm/s and the arterial waveform with the peak systolic velocity of 10 to 54.8 cm/s, resistance index ranged from 0. 31 to 0. 57. Pulsed Doppler of the inferior turbinate showed a venous waveform with the velocity ranging from 4. 0 to 17. 3 cm/s and the arterial waveform with the peak systolic velocity of 7.5 to 79.6 cm/s, resistance index ranged from 0.25 to 0.62. Conclusions With correction factor,nasal endoscopic ultrasonography was accurate in localizing structures with clear images and high resolution. It could be a new imaging modality of diagnosing nasal mucosal and submucosal disorderes.
